  • Chicago Brewseum
    Content Specialist
    Chicago Brewseum May 2018 - Nov 2018
    Worked with a design team to create a museum exhibit focused on Chicago brewing history. Assisted in creation of exhibit narrative, conducted historical research, wrote label copy, provided feedback to other team members, and generated awareness through social media and public talks.The exhibit showcases the growth of Chicago's brewing industry from the city's founding to the World's Columbian Exposition in 1893, using beer as a lens to discuss the German community's pursuit of local citizenship as well as the general growth of the city.
